While we’re waiting on Star Trek: Discovery season 3 to arrive on CBS All Access, we’re also wondering how long it’s going to be until Star Trek: Picard season 2 can go before cameras. Unfortunately, as with countless other TV series right now, the Patrick Stewart vehicle has been held up by the lockdown. Ep Akiva Goldsman has previously revealed it was due to start shooting this June, and while that’s not going to happen anymore, he’s promised that work will begin as soon as possible.
Now, one of the show’s stars has given us a further update. Jeri Ryan recently took part in a Stars in the House video call with the cast of Star Trek: Voyager. When the conversation turned to Picard, Ryan echoed Goldsman’s comments that a June start date was expected, but added that the new plan is to resume production sometime in the fall.
